首页 数码热点文章正文

MySQL中误删数据后的数据恢复方法(通过备份和日志恢复数据,保障数据安全)

数码热点 2025年06月23日 10:30 141 游客

在使用MySQL数据库过程中,误删数据是一个常见的问题,可能导致重要数据的丢失。本文将介绍一些常用的方法,帮助用户在误删数据后进行有效的恢复,以保障数据的安全。

1.使用备份文件进行数据恢复

备份是防止数据丢失的重要手段。如果有定期备份数据库的习惯,可以通过备份文件将误删的数据恢复回来。

2.利用Binlog日志进行数据恢复

MySQL的Binlog日志记录了数据库的所有操作,包括删除操作。可以通过分析Binlog日志,找到误删数据的操作记录,并进行数据恢复。

3.使用全量备份和增量备份结合的方式进行数据恢复

全量备份和增量备份结合是一种更加灵活且安全的数据恢复方式。全量备份用于还原数据库到某个时间点,而增量备份则用于恢复最新的操作记录。

4.利用第三方工具进行数据恢复

除了MySQL自带的工具外,还有一些第三方工具可以帮助用户进行数据恢复,如MyDumper、MyLoader等,可以根据具体需求选择合适的工具进行数据恢复。

5.预防误删数据的操作

预防胜于治疗,为了避免误删数据的发生,需要注意规范操作,并设置合适的权限和备份策略。

6.数据恢复的风险与注意事项

数据恢复过程中存在一定的风险,可能导致数据的进一步损坏或者丢失。在进行数据恢复时,需谨慎操作,备份原有数据,以防止意外发生。

7.数据恢复的时间成本和资源消耗

数据恢复需要耗费一定的时间和资源,特别是在大型数据库中,恢复过程可能会比较耗时。在进行数据恢复前需要评估时间成本和资源消耗。

8.日常监控和维护数据库的重要性

定期监控和维护数据库是保障数据安全的重要手段。通过及时发现问题并进行修复,可以最大程度地减少误删数据的风险。

9.如何避免频繁误删数据

频繁误删数据可能是操作不规范或者权限设置不当造成的。通过加强培训、规范操作流程以及合理设置权限,可以避免频繁误删数据的发生。

10.数据恢复后的后续操作

数据恢复后,需要进行一些后续操作,如更新数据备份、修复相关应用程序等,以确保数据库恢复正常运行。

11.数据备份与恢复策略的制定

制定合适的数据备份与恢复策略对于数据安全至关重要。需要根据业务需求和系统实际情况,合理制定备份和恢复策略,并定期进行评估和更新。

12.数据库管理员的角色和职责

数据库管理员在保障数据库安全方面扮演着重要的角色。他们需要负责制定安全策略、监控数据库运行状态、备份与恢复等工作,以确保数据库的稳定性和安全性。

13.建立紧急响应机制

在误删数据发生后,需要建立紧急响应机制,迅速采取措施进行数据恢复,并评估数据丢失的影响范围,及时采取补救措施。

14.恢复后的数据验证与测试

数据恢复后,需要进行数据验证和测试,确保恢复的数据准确无误,并与之前的数据保持一致。

15.持续改进数据恢复策略

数据恢复策略需要与时俱进,不断改进和完善。根据实际情况和经验教训,定期审查和更新数据恢复策略,以提高数据安全性和恢复效率。

在MySQL中误删数据是一个常见的问题,但通过备份和日志恢复等方法,可以有效地解决数据丢失的问题。同时,建立紧急响应机制、制定合适的备份与恢复策略以及加强监控和维护工作也是保障数据安全的重要手段。

标签: ???????

未来科技网声明:本站所发布的文字与配图均来自互联网改编或整理,我们不做任何商业用途,版权归原作者所有,由于部分内容无法与权利人取得联系,
如侵权或涉及违法,请联系我们删除,QQ:332172417。
滇ICP备2023008968号